Mr. Lloyd

Now that these reports of the exceptionally fine medical work

6

performed in Hong Kong during the intern- ment period by Dr. Selwyn-Clarke and his doctors we again available you should certainly see it and I suggest Sir George Gater and Mr. Creech-Jones would be interested.

Dr. Selwyn-Clarke has his critics but as an energetic and efficient D.M.S. the Hong Kong stage has provided him with an exceptional opportunity to show his very remarkable qualities. As you know, he was awarded a C.M.G. before the liberation of Hong Kong on the information which reached us as to the value of the work he had been doing and whatever his critics may say as to his forceful methods of achieving his professional purposes, I am sure that no-one here or in Hong Kong will under-estimate the immense value of his work in the Colony in the face of Japanese suspicion and the ordeal of imprisonment for a long period at their hands.
